Leather Belt Bag Workshop with Ellie Lum of Klum House!

Ellie Lum is a bag maker, pattern designer, and teacher. She’s also the founder of Klum House, a bag making shop and school in Portland, Oregon, that offers kits, patterns, supplies, and classes—everything you need to become a bag maker! Her favorite materials to work with are waxed canvas and leather for their durability and timeless aesthetic.

Peony & Anemone Crepe Paper Flowers Workshop with Sandra Gaestel!

Create everlasting floral arrangements using crepe paper, floral wires, and natural accents to make realistic peonies and anemones. Sandra Gaestrel, owner and designer of Harley Rose Florals, shares her love of paper flowers along with her expertise in crafting these forever springtime blooms. “My love for flowers was instilled in me by my mom who taught me to love and appreciate nature in its wild and natural form,” she says. Working with floral designers allowed Sandra the opportunity to study the small details of many different blooms and bring that knowledge into her crepe paper flower creations.
